Preparation of novel antibacterial agents. Replacement of the central aromatic ring with heterocycles
Li, Jianke,Wakefield, Brian D.,Ruble, J. Craig,Stiff, Cory M.,Romero, Donna L.,Marotti, Keith R.,Sweeney, Michael T.,Zurenko, Gary E.,Rohrer, Douglas C.,Thorarensen, Atli
, p. 2347 - 2350 (2008/12/21)
Discovery of novel antibacterial agents is a significant challenge. We have recently reported on our discovery of novel antibacterial agents in which we have rapidly optimized potency utilizing a parallel chemistry approach. These advanced leads suffer from high affinity for human serum albumin (HSA). In an effort to decrease the affinity for HSA we have prepared a series of heterocyclic analogs, which retained antibacterial activity and demonstrated reduced affinity for HSA.
